MOT History from tests of petrol NISSAN STAGEAs year 1998

Review the list of common NISSAN STAGEA failures below or to perform a specific mot history check on your NISSAN then use our popular KnowYourCar service

mot history
Pass percent:70.59%
(The average a petrol NISSAN STAGEA year 1998 passes without issue)
Based on:204 MOT Tests
Most common failuresNo# failures
Headlamp aim out of alignment16
Exhaust emissions Lambda reading after 2nd fast idle outside specified limits |7.3.D.3|7
Exhaust emissions carbon monoxide content after 2nd fast idle excessive |7.3.D.3|6
Rear fog lamp not working |1.3.2b|5
Brake pipe excessively corroded4
Rear fog lamp tell tale not working |1.3.1b|4

We get to these numbers by trawling through over 1 billion MOT test results since 2004 and crunched the numbers. We remove anything to do with Tyres, as they are model independent and group together common non-model specific issues. We are trying to get to a picture of what models have what issues.

Please note: We take the data from the DVSA. This data is raw and can contain typos and spelling mistakes that garages may have entered while recording a MOT result. Specifically miss-match on names of models and makes. We are constantly cleaning the data so bear with the odd issue.
